RESPONSIBILITIES:
1. The nature and scope of this role is to support the Treasurer’s function that deals with the PAPSS settlement initiative. The incumbent will support the Treasurer and take a supervisory lead role in ensuring that the PAPSS Settlement Process is effectively and efficiently run;
2. The role will also support the Treasurer in developing a solid best-in-class treasury PAPSS function which is a go-to all PAPSS settlement activities;
3. The role will further support the Treasurer in crafting and executing a treasury PAPSS Settlement Operational Strategy that reduces the PAPSS Participants’ Hers tat risk and ensures that each Participants’ financial obligations are made good as they fall due at the end-of-day;

Treasury PAPSS Settlement Management
1. Manage the daily treasury PAPSS settlement and confirmation processes ensuring that all payments are confirmed and executed within defined cut-off times;
2. The approval and release of payments that may require human intervention from a settlement perspective, to participants;

Treasury PAPSS Activities Analysis
1. Analyse all final approved inter-participant settlement stage transactions into the general ledger;
2. Responsible for the end-to-end overdraft and collateral management in the PAPSS system as well as the Core Banking system;
3. Monitor all of participating parties Overdraft Loan activities and review performance on a periodic basis;

Treasury PAPSS Reconciliations and Investigations
1. Responsible for all PAPSS settlement reconciliations and overdraft utilisations on an intra-day and end of day basis;
2. Responsible for the investigation and resolution of any claims or queries relating to the PAPSS participants’ activities on the platform;
3. Responsible for ensuring that all matters are closed and highlighted in the PAPSS end-of-day report;

Treasury PAPSS Settlement Data Ownership and Custody
1. Ownership and safe custody of all treasury PAPSS settlement data valuable for research analytics;
2. Responsible for the storage and recording of off-site settlement data necessary for the Bank’s research activities that relate to the PAPSS initiative;
3. Supporting the PAPSS Participating parties’ teams in all aspects of settlements by learning their responsibilities also and using the knowledge to improve the PAPSS efficiency;

Treasury PAPSS Reporting, Team management and Communication
1. Maintaining and providing periodic treasury PAPSS Settlement reporting to senior management as and when required;
2. Work closely with Finance and other stakeholders to ensure that all accounting processes take account of the complexities associated with settlement and banking;
3. Responsible for maintaining effective communication channels with participating entities, and colleagues including Management on matters that relate to PAPSS settlement activities;
4. Responsible for ensuring that within the treasury PAPSS team there is adequate cover during absences by initiating frequent staff training and practice sessions;
5. Responsible for ensuring that all PAPSS functional activities are fully documented, including a periodical update;
